右前额带状皮质调解产前并发症对年轻人内化行为的影响

概括
产前并发症与脑前部灰质体积 (GMV) 的减少以及儿童内行为增加有关. 额头的GMV调解了这种关联,这表明了发展内化症状的途径.

背景情况:
- 产科并发症是精神疾病的已知危险因素.
- 童年和青春期是大脑和行为发展的关键时期.
- 需要明确产科并发症,行为和大脑结构之间的联系.
研究的目的:
- 调查产前/产周并发症,行为问题和儿童和青少年大脑体积之间的关联.
- 探索大脑结构在这种关系中的调解作用.
主要方法:
- 82名患有情绪行为问题的儿童/青少年接受了临床和3T脑部MRI.
- 使用儿童行为检查清单/6-18 (CBCL/6-18) 收集的行为数据.
- 统计分析包括一般化的线性模型和调解模型.
主要成果:
- 产前并发症与更高的CBCL/6-18撤回得分有关.
- 观察到右上额头回形和前带皮层的灰质体积 (GMV) 减少.
- 调解分析显示,正面GMV调解了产前并发症和隐蔽行为之间的联系.
结论:
- 产科并发症在改变大脑结构和行为方面发挥着重要作用.
- 额头的GMV可能会调解产前并发症和内化症状之间的关系.
- 研究结果表明,在有风险的年轻人中,预防性干预的潜在目标是.

Att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ental disorder characterized by persistent in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. It affects approximately 5-8% of children globally, with around 60-70% of cases persisting into adulthood. ADHD has significant implications for educational attainment, social interactions, and occupational success.

The cerebellum, while traditionally associated with motor control, also plays a crucial role in memory, particularly in procedural memory, which involves learning motor tasks that become automatic through repetition. For example, studies have shown that when the cerebellum is damaged, individuals or animals lose the ability to learn conditioned motor responses, such as the conditioned eye-blink response in classical conditioning experiments with rabbits. During adolescence, individuals experience significant cognitive development that enhances their understanding of others' emotions and thoughts, known as cognitive empathy. This period is marked by an increased ability to adapt to others' perspectives and a more nuanced understanding of others' mental states, a skill that is foundational for social problem-solving and conflict avoidance. The information-processing theory of cognitive development centers on fundamental mental processes, including attention, memory, and problem-solving skills. Researchers in this field examine how cognitive abilities, such as working memory, evolve and influence children's overall development. Studies indicate that children with stronger working memory tend to excel in reading comprehension, math, and problem-solving compared to peers with less efficient memory skills.
